Cucumber Sandwiches with Dill Cream Cheese: A Classic Bridal Shower Bite

These elegant finger sandwiches are a timeless bridal shower favorite. They're refreshing, easy to make, and visually appealing. Perfect for a sophisticated afternoon tea party.

Yields: Approximately 24 sandwiches Prep time: 20 minutes

Ingredients:

  • 1 loaf (8 ounces) white bread, crusts removed
  • 8 ounces cream cheese, softened
  • 2 tablespoons fresh dill, chopped
  • 1 teaspoon lemon juice
  • Sal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ste
  • 1 cucumber, thinly sliced

Instructions:

  1. In a medium bowl, combine softened cream cheese, chopped dill, and lemon juice. Season with salt and pepper to taste. Mix well until thoroughly combined.
  2. Spread a thin layer of the dill cream cheese mixture onto one slice of bread. Top with several cucumber slices.
  3. Place another slice of bread on top to create a sandwich.
  4. Cut each sandwich into four smaller finger sandwiches using a sharp knife.
  5. Arrange the sandwiches on a platter and garnish with fresh dill sprigs (optional).

Tips & Variations:

  • For a richer flavor, use a flavored cream cheese such as chive and onion cream cheese.
  • If you don't have fresh dill, you can substitute with 1 teaspoon of dried dill.
  • Try adding a thin layer of thinly sliced tomato or red onion for added flavor and color.

Mini Quiches: A Savory and Satisfying Choice

Mini quiches are a fantastic option for a bridal shower. They're easy to eat, visually appealing, and can be prepared ahead of time. These individual quiches offer a delightful savory contrast to sweeter treats.

Yields: 12 mini quiches Prep time: 20 minutes Cook time: 20-25 minutes

Ingredients:

  • 1 package (14.1 ounces) refrigerated pie crusts
  • 6 large eggs
  • 1 cup milk
  • 1/2 cup shredded cheddar cheese
  • 1/4 cup chopped cooked bacon or ham
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ions:

  1.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C).
  2. Unroll pie crusts and cut out 12 circles using a 3-inch cookie cutter or a glass.
  3. Press each circle into a mini muffin tin.
  4. In a large bowl, whisk together eggs, milk, salt, and pepper.
  5. Stir in cheddar cheese and cooked bacon or ham.
  6. Pour egg mixture into the prepared pie crusts, filling each about ¾ full.
  7. Bake for 20-25 minutes, or until the quiches are set and lightly golden brown.
  8. Let cool slightly before serving.

Tips & Variations:

  • Use different types of cheese, such as Gruyere or Swiss cheese.
  • Add sautéed vegetables like spinach, mushrooms, or onions.
  • Use pre-cooked chicken or sausage instead of bacon or ham.
